Honeysql has to be one of the best examples of data transformation
where Clojure really shines. {domain-data} -> {honey-sql data} -> SQL.
Love it.

I understand YeSQL's sweet spot is where the SQL is static except for
parameters so yeah, not applicable for building up queries at runtime.
Still, if SQL is known up front then it seems very nice.

> On Feb 24, 2015, at 9:16 AM, Colin Yates <colin.ya...@gmail.com> wrote:
>> I am surprised that yesql isn't more adopted, particularly now named
>> parameters is there - has anyone run into roadblocks with it?
>
> Most of our SQL is dynamically created -- data-driven -- so YeSQL isn't 
> really a good fit, as I understand it. We're either building SQL from a map 
> of key/value pairs or from composable pieces using HoneySQL (for our complex 
> reports that are all driven by data as well).
